Output 1ba5baa1a35dcbdf31d660665cf476a7c6b8fbd298147b396c88b5343a11daf7:5

value
172318210
script pubkey
OP_0 OP_PUSHBYTES_20 e24b1e87f3821d4718b377f4024e933ec474dc0f
address
bc1quf93aplnsgw5wx9nwl6qyn5n8mz8fhq02xp8zn
transaction
1ba5baa1a35dcbdf31d660665cf476a7c6b8fbd298147b396c88b5343a11daf7
spent
true